About the Author
Dr. Duke received his DVM degree from Auburn University in 1983 and has practiced veterinary medicine on the Mississippi Gulf Coast for over 41 years, 40 of which as a practice co-owner or owner.Ā His group practice has been AAHA-certified since 1987.Ā Dr. Duke has served in many positions on his state and local veterinary medical associations (VMAs) and was elected veterinarian of the year by the Mississippi VMA in 2019. As well as treating more than his share of heartworm cases over the years, he has served on the AHS board of directors since 2016.Ā He was president of the AHS from 2019 to 2022 and now serves as past president.
